Radiology Unit Coordinator Part Time Mid-Combination Shift primary shift 9a-5pm and 2p-10p Various (Req#7330) Carthage Area Hospital
Schedules patients for examinations, performs all duties associated with it, collects data for the department Quality Improvement program and does daily runs to the off-site storage area for patient film file jackets.
Requirements :
Radiology Medical Terminology.
Computer skills, Pacs system and Hospital Information system.
Possess and demonstrates knowledge of the appropriate terminology utilized to provide care for infant through geriatric age population served as is relevant to radiology procedures.
Assist Imaging tech with scanning documents in PACS system
Assist Imaging tech with transporting patients
